Product Development Analyst (Entry-Level)


Remote-first · Product Development & Merchandising · Full-time


About Americanflat
Americanflat makes home décor stylish, affordable, and accessible. Our curated selection helps people transform their spaces into inviting, personalized homes. As a remote-first, fast-growing company with a globally distributed team, we run on lean principles, direct communication, and collaboration, where every team member's input is valued.


About the Role
As an entry-level Product Development Analyst, you'll be the analytical engine behind what we build and sell next. You'll research market trends, dig into sales and marketplace data, and translate consumer feedback into insights that shape our product assortment. This is a data-meets-creativity role: you'll spot emerging styles, benchmark competitors, track how our SKUs perform on Amazon and beyond, and turn what you find into clear recommendations for the Product Development and Merchandising teams.


What You'll Do


Market & Trend Research
• Research emerging trends, styles, and consumer preferences in home décor
• Benchmark competitor products on features, pricing, imagery, and positioning
• Identify white-space and market-gap opportunities to inform product ideas


Data & Performance Analysis
• Analyze sales data and consumer feedback to optimize the product assortment
• Track KPIs such as sell-through rate, margin, inventory turnover, and weeks/months of cover
• Monitor SKU performance on Amazon (sales trends, pricing, listing quality) and flag best and worst performers


Reporting & Recommendations
• Build and maintain recurring reports and presentations on product performance, trends, and insights
• Recommend improvements to pricing, listings, images, promotions, and product specs (this role suggests and supports; it does not set final strategy)
• Support data entry and maintenance of the master product database


Collaboration
• Partner with Design, Product Development, Merchandising, and Marketing to support data-driven decisions across the product lifecycle


What We're Looking For
• 0–2 years of experience in analytics, merchandising, e-commerce, or a related field (internships count)
• Strong Excel/Google Sheets skills and comfort working with data
• An analytical mindset with strong attention to detail
• Interest in home décor, retail, or consumer products
• Clear written communication for reports and recommendations
• Bonus: familiarity with Amazon Seller/Vendor Central or marketplace data
